Health Care LA Ipa

Fiscal year ending 2024. Filed on November 18, 2025.

4195 E Thousand Oaks Blvd 235
Thousand Oaks, California 91362

Health Care LA Ipa (EIN: 95-4298276)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Health Care LA Ipa,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 1 out of 1 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$412,920. The highest compensated employee at Health Care LA Ipa is Sabra Matovsky with fiscal year 2024 compensation of $412,920.

Mission Statement

HEALTH CARE LA IPA'S (HCLA) MISSION IS TO PROVIDE COMMUNITY-BASED PROVIDERS IN LOS ANGELES COUNTY WITH A MANAGED, INTEGRATED HEALTHCARE DELIVERY SYSTEM TO SERVE THEIR COMMUNITIES IN AN ORGANIZED, EFFICIENT, COMPASSIONATE AND FINANCIALLY RESPONSIBLE MANNER.
